Abstract
The high endothelial venule (HEV)-content
and the lymphocyte migration index (LMI) of reactive
lymph nodes and lymph nodes from patients with B-cell
chronic lymphocytic leukaemia (B-CLL), as well as
some related B-cell malignancies (lymphocytic
lymphoma -LL-, prolymphocytic leukaemia -PLL-) were
determined and statistically analyzed. The HEV-content
and the LMI were significantly higher in reactive lymph
nodes than in the low grade B-cell lymphomas and
leukaemias (p< 0.001). The number of HEVs among
lymphoma/leukaemia cases was the highest in LL
independently of the maturation. However, the
maturation of the process seems to determine the
intensity of lymphocyte migration; i.e. a significantly
higher LMI was found in mature (B-CLL, PF, mature; M
and LL, M) than in immature subtypes (B-CLL, PF,
immature -1M-, diffuse -D- and LL, IM) subtypes (levels
of significance varied from p< 0.05 to p< 0.001). Rased
on these findings, a more intense migration of
lymphocytes from blood to peripheral lymph nodes may
be supposed in LL than in B-CLL, thus explaining the
nodal sites of involvement in LL and the peripheral
blood in B-CLL. Within the same histological categories
the morphometric features in mature subtypes may
implicate an enhanced HEV-lymphocyte interaction
when compared to the immature subtypes.
